UN Adopts Convention on Enforced Disappearance

December 20th, 2006 at 06:42pm

On December 20, the United Nations General Assembly adopted an International Convention for the Protection of All Persons from Enforced Disappearance.  The Convention had been co-sponsored by over 100 member states.
